BHT FEED GRADE TEST refers to Butylated Hydroxy Toluene, specifically formulated for feed-quality use and analyzed to satisfy stringent good quality and security expectations. BHT can be a lipophilic organic and natural compound which is mostly employed as an antioxidant in many industrial apps. In animal diet, BHT FEED GRADE TEST is widely used to circumvent the oxidation of fats and oils in animal feed, therefore preserving the nutritional value and increasing the shelf life of the feed. Oxidized fats not only reduce nutritional efficacy but might also make dangerous compounds, influencing the overall health and development of livestock. The inclusion of BHT in feed requires demanding testing to guarantee it adheres to regulatory specifications and is Safe and sound for consumption by animals, which finally enters the human foods chain. The tests protocols normally evaluate the purity, efficacy, and possible residues in animal tissues.

A different essential compound from the chemical domain is Pentachloropyridine. This compound can be a chlorinated spinoff of pyridine and has garnered curiosity as a consequence of its utility as an intermediate while in the synthesis of agrochemicals, dyes, and prescription drugs. Its higher degree of chlorination causes it to be a powerful compound, which needs to be handled with care on account of potential toxicity and environmental issues. Pentachloropyridine serves being a setting up block in chemical synthesis, permitting chemists to build additional elaborate molecules Which might be Employed in herbicides, insecticides, or perhaps specialty polymers. The handling and disposal of Pentachloropyridine are regulated, offered its prospective environmental persistence and bioaccumulation chance. Industries working with this compound typically adopt closed-method manufacturing strategies and rigorous safety protocols to attenuate publicity.

M-Phenylene Diamine, normally abbreviated as MPD, can be an aromatic amine that options prominently during the creation of aramid fibers, which happen to be perfectly-recognized for their heat resistance and toughness. Kevlar and Nomex, Employed in human body armor and fire-resistant clothing, respectively, are generated working with MPD like a important precursor. The compound alone is made up of a benzene ring with two amino groups during the meta positions, which makes it suitable for building polymers with appealing thermal and mechanical properties. M-Phenylene Diamine (MPD) is usually Utilized in the dye industry, specially in hair dyes and also other cosmetic programs, although its use has actually been curtailed in some areas due to security fears. When manufacturing solutions containing MPD, suitable occupational protection methods are important to protect employees from extended publicity, which could lead to pores and skin sensitization or other health issues.

O-Phenylene Diamine (OPDA), although structurally comparable to MPD, differs inside the positioning with the amino teams, which substantially influences its chemical reactivity and software. OPDA is frequently used from the creation of dyes and pigments, exactly where it contributes on the development of vivid hues that are stable and extended-lasting. Additionally it is Utilized in the synthesis of heterocyclic compounds and prescribed drugs. OPDA’s function in corrosion inhibitors and rubber chemical substances even more highlights its versatility. Nevertheless, much like other aromatic amines, OPDA can be connected to toxicity challenges, and therefore, its use is thoroughly controlled and monitored. The significance of appropriate handling, appropriate storage, and adequate protecting actions cannot be overstated when handling OPDA in any industrial setting.

Pinacolone is yet another noteworthy compound with a range of programs. It's a ketone Using the molecular components C6H12O which is utilised mainly being an intermediate while in the synthesis of pesticides and herbicides, specifically in the manufacture of triazole fungicides and particular plant advancement regulators. Pinacolone’s BHT FEED GRADE-TEST framework features a tertiary butyl group, which contributes to its one of a kind reactivity in organic and natural synthesis. Beyond agriculture, it can even be found in the manufacture of prescribed drugs and fragrances. Pinacolone is valued for its ability to go through nucleophilic substitution and condensation reactions, rendering it a useful reagent in laboratory and industrial procedures. Whilst it can be much less dangerous than some of the Formerly reviewed compounds, safety precautions are still needed to mitigate any risks linked to its volatility and opportunity irritant Qualities.

2-Heptanone can be a ketone that naturally occurs in some plants and is additionally present in compact portions in human sweat and certain animal secretions. It is commonly used in the fragrance and flavor industries because of its nice, fruity odor. Moreover, two-Heptanone has located apps for a solvent and intermediate in natural and organic synthesis. Apparently, investigate has prompt that it may well Participate in a job in chemical signaling, specially in insects, wherever it functions as an alarm pheromone. This has led to its study in pest control strategies and behavioral science. Industrially, two-Heptanone is synthesized to be used in coatings, adhesives, and cleaners. Its comparatively minimal toxicity makes it suitable for use in purchaser solutions, While acceptable labeling and handling Guidance are generally mandated.
